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Foundation: Larger foundations require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Foundation: Choices such as slab, crawl space, or basement foundations can significantly impact pricing.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ional preparation and reinforcement, adding to the expense.
- Accessibility of the Site: Difficult-to-access sites may require special equipment and additional labor, raising costs.
-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Baton Rouge, LA can vary, affecting the total price of the project.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ials will naturally cost more but can offer better durability and longevity.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which come with their own fees.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Baton Rouge, LA)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Excavation | $1,500 - $5,000 |
Concrete Pouring (per sq ft) | $4 - $8 |
Reinforcement (rebar)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Waterproofing | $500 - $2,000 |
Finishing and Leveling |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Inspections and Permits | $500 - $1,500 |
